Universal Sentence Structure

A Realization in Spanish*

 

A thing occupies three-dimensional space and one-dimensional time. When language is expression of cognition, consisting of four dimensions as a whole, the minimum unit of language is a sentence. Therefore, the structure of cognition should correspond to that of sentences.

The first thing recognized at the beginning of time is expressed in the subject. The change or time is expressed in the VERJECT, distinct from the part of speech 'verb'. The end of the change is expressed in the direct object and the third party, in the indirect object. 

 

FORMULA 3 Expression of the Four-Dimensional Structure

 

             Sentence = Subject + Verject + Direct object + Indirect object

                                                                                                      (In no special order)
